Abstract
The utility model discloses a kind of milling machine tables of adjustment height, including pedestal, by being equipped with the second driving motor in pedestal, the output end of second driving motor is equipped with shaft, shaft is equipped with the first angular wheel, support rod is equipped with below second angular wheel, second angular wheel is equipped with internal screw thread bar, threaded rod is equipped in internal screw thread bar, the top of threaded rod is equipped with bearing, the first angular wheel is driven by the second driving motor, first angular wheel drives the second angular wheel, rotate the internal screw thread bar on the second angular wheel, to make threaded rod rotation rise, bearing is equipped on the top of threaded rod, guarantee that milling machine table will not rotate rising, auxiliary support apparatus is symmetrically arranged in milling machine table two sides of the bottom, it can play the role of Auxiliary support, the utility model has the advantages that such apparatus structure is simple, it is easy to use, Precision when operation can be increased, reduce error, increase efficiency.

Background technique
Milling machine refers mainly to the lathe processed with milling cutter to a variety of surfaces of workpiece.Usual milling cutter is transported based on rotary motion
Dynamic, the movement of workpiece and milling cutter is feed motion.It can process plane, groove, can also process various curved surfaces, gear etc..
Milling machine is the lathe for carrying out Milling Process to workpiece with milling cutter.Milling machine is except energy milling plane, groove, the gear teeth, screw thread and splined shaft
Outside, moreover it is possible to process more complicated type face, efficiency is used widely compared with planer height in machine-building and repairing department.
Existing milling machine when processing the workpiece, relies primarily on the distance of adjustment milling head to adjust the work of milling head and workpieces processing
Make distance;However, the processing swing arm of milling head is too long, it is easy to make the accuracy of processing to reduce, the required precision of processing is not achieved, it is raw
The inefficiency of production.
For the problems in the relevant technologies, currently no effective solution has been proposed.
